SFTP Source
Provided by: "Apache Software Foundation"
Receive data from an SFTP Server.
Configuration Options
The following table summarizes the configuration options available for the sftp-source
Kamelet:
Property | Name | Description | Type | Default | Example |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
directoryName * | Directory Name | The starting directory | string | ||
host * | Host | Hostname of the SFTP server | string | ||
password * | Password | The password to access the SFTP server | string | ||
port * | Port | Port of the FTP server | string |
| |
username * | Username | The username to access the SFTP server | string | ||
idempotent | Idempotency | Skip already processed files. | boolean |
| |
passiveMode | Passive Mode | Sets passive mode connection | boolean |
| |
recursive | Recursive | If a directory, will look for files in all the sub-directories as well. | boolean |
|
Fields marked with (*) are mandatory. |
Usage
This section summarizes how the sftp-source
can be used in various contexts.
Knative Source
The sftp-source
Kamelet can be used as Knative source by binding it to a Knative object.
apiVersion: camel.apache.org/v1alpha1
kind: KameletBinding
metadata:
name: sftp-source-binding
spec:
source:
ref:
kind: Kamelet
apiVersion: camel.apache.org/v1alpha1
name: sftp-source
properties:
directoryName: "The Directory Name"
host: "The Host"
password: "The Password"
username: "The Username"
sink:
ref:
kind: InMemoryChannel
apiVersion: messaging.knative.dev/v1
name: mychannel
Make sure you have Camel K installed into the Kubernetes cluster you’re connected to.
Save the sftp-source-binding.yaml
file into your hard drive, then configure it according to your needs.
You can run the source using the following command:
kubectl apply -f sftp-source-binding.yaml
